How much do quality lab man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 26, 2026, the average yearly pay for quality lab manager in Beaumont, TX is $82,541.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,200.00 and $130,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a quality lab manager do?

A Quality Lab Manager oversees the operations of a laboratory dedicated to quality assurance and control. They are responsible for managing lab staff, ensuring that testing procedures comply with industry standards, and maintaining the accuracy and reliability of test results. Their duties also include developing and implementing quality control protocols, troubleshooting equipment or procedural issues, and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ements. Ultimately, a Quality Lab Manager plays a critical role in ensuring products meet safety and quality standards before reaching consumers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a quality lab man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Quality Lab Manager, you need a solid background in laboratory science, quality assurance methodologies, and a relevant degree such as chemistry, biology, or engineering. Familiarity with laboratory information management systems (LIMS), ISO standards (like ISO 17025), and regulatory compliance certifications are typ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help foster team performance and uphold quality standards. These abilities are crucial for ensuring accurate testing, regulatory compliance, and continuous improvement in laboratory operations.

What are some common challenges a quality lab manager faces, and how can they be addressed?

A Quality Lab Manager often encounters challenges such as balancing tight production deadlines with the need for thorough testing, ensuring compliance with evolving industry regulations, and managing a diverse team of technicians. To address these challenges, strong organizational skills, effective communication, and continuous staff training are essential. Staying updated on regulatory changes and implementing robust quality management systems can help maintain high standards while meeting business objectives.

What is the difference between Quality Lab Manager vs Quality Control Technician?

AspectQuality Lab ManagerQuality Control Technician
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in a science or engineering field; certifications like ASQ CQE are commonUsually requires a high school diploma or associate degree; certifications like CQCT are advantageous
Work EnvironmentOversees laboratory operations, manages staff, and ensures compliance in a lab settingPerforms testing and inspections directly on products or materials in a lab or production environment
ResponsibilitiesManaging quality systems, coordinating testing procedures, and ensuring regulatory complianceConducting tests, recording data, and identifying quality issues

The main difference is that the Quality Lab Manager oversees the entire laboratory operations and staff, focusing on management and compliance, while the Quality Control Technician performs hands-on testing and data collection. Both roles are essential in maintaining product quality but differ in scope and responsibilities.

Position: Quality Supervisor
Job Code: MQMQM2 + Supv, Quality
Location: Evadale, TX
The Opportunity:
In this role you will assist QA Dept. with support for the various Quality Systems at the Evadale Mill. You will help to sustain, build, and develop a "Best in class organization" to support the long-term growth of the business. You will help drive the execution of Quality Assurance's mission to provide accurate, relevant, and timely quality information for Evadale Mill's products to meet or exceed end use expectations for performance and consistency.
How you will impact Smurfit WestRock:
  • Supervise the Hourly Quality Lab Employees.
  • Supervise all Quality lab testing, qualifications, hourly work schedule, supplies & inventory, material qualifications, and coordinate QA work orders.
  • Manage the training program for all hourly Quality lab employees.
  • Assist in product recall situations.
  • Provide technical support for paper testing lab activities and special project assignments.
  • Support implementation of new test methods that require comparative analysis.
  • Provide support to the ISO 9001:2015 Quality Management System and ISO 22001:2015 Food Safety system.
  • Participate in QA Call Duty rotation.
  • Oversee customer and internal Smurfit WestRock sample program.
  • Manage paper machine Outturn Room.
  • Provides backup support for the QA Engineer, QA Equipment Reliability Coordinator, and the QA Manager as needed.
  • Any other duties as assigned.

What you need to exceed:
  • Bachelor's degree or minimum of 3 years' experience in Quality and/or manufacturing experience in Pulp/Paper. BS degree in Pulp & Paper Science related scientific field is preferred.
  • Strong diagnostic problem-solving skills.
  • Proficiency with Excel, SAP, Testream, Optivision, Microsoft Teams, Workforce Solutions is a plus.
  • Good verbal and written communication skills for dealing with diverse audiences.
  • Strong work ethic and desire to improve systems and processes.
